(mysql.info.gz) mysql_select_db
Info Catalog
(mysql.info.gz) mysql_row_tell
(mysql.info.gz) C API functions
(mysql.info.gz) mysql_set_server_option
22.2.3.52 `mysql_select_db()'
.............................
`int mysql_select_db(MYSQL *mysql, const char *db)'
Description
...........
Causes the database specified by `db' to become the default (current)
database on the connection specified by `mysql'. In subsequent queries,
this database is the default for table references that do not include an
explicit database specifier.
`mysql_select_db()' fails unless the connected user can be authenticated
as having permission to use the database.
Return Values
.............
Zero for success. Non-zero if an error occurred.
Errors
......
`CR_COMMANDS_OUT_OF_SYNC'
Commands were executed in an improper order.
`CR_SERVER_GONE_ERROR'
The MySQL server has gone away.
`CR_SERVER_LOST'
The connection to the server was lost during the query.
`CR_UNKNOWN_ERROR'
An unknown error occurred.
Info Catalog
(mysql.info.gz) mysql_row_tell
(mysql.info.gz) C API functions
(mysql.info.gz) mysql_set_server_option
automatically generated byinfo2html